Striking, bold sterling and natural green stone bracelet by Erika Hult De Corral who signs her work "RIC". She trained as an artist in Paris and then moved to Taxco in the 60s where she apprenticed with Sigi Pineda. This is a vintage RIC piece and bears the eagle mark along with her signature. The bracelet measures 7 1/4" around in the inside and is 1 1/8" wide. Weighing 95 grams, it is in fine original condition. The stones are impressive and free of cracks of chips. Circular silver pin/pendant with triangles of azur malachite finished with a bead at each tip with removable original chain by William Spratling. This pin is pictured on page 48 of the new edition of the book MEXICAN SILVER by Morrill and Berk. According to the Spratlingsilver.com website, this was one of the last designs Spratling created for Spratling y Artesanos and this design was one of sixty Spratling agreed to provide the company after his resignation in July 1945.
